Ransomware Protection
The Anti-ransomware feature uses Quick Heal's behavior-based detection technology that analyzes the behavior of programs in real time. This helps in detecting and blocking ransomware. This feature also backs up your data in a secure location to help you restore your files in case of a ransomware attack.

Advanced DNAScan
Quick Heal DNAScan technology detects and blocks unknown threats by analyzing the behavior of downloaded programs.
Vulnerability Scan
Vulnerability Scan helps you detect security weaknesses that attackers can use to hijack your computer. The feature also helps you fix vulnerabilities that could be present in the OS settings.
Virtual Keyboard
Data-stealing software record what you type on your keyboard, and send the information to attackers. This can be prevented by using the Virtual Keyboard. Any information typed on this keyboard gets encrypted and cannot be recorded or accessed by anyone.

To use Quick Heal Total Security Multi-Device, your system must meet the following minimum requirements. However, we recommend that your system should have higher configuration to obtain better results.
Note:
- The requirements are applicable to all flavors of the operating systems.
- The requirements are applicable to the 32-bit and 64-bit operating systems unless specifically mentioned.
General requirements
- Internet Explorer 6 or later
- Internet connection to receive updates and activate the software
- 1.9 GB hard disk space
System requirements for various Microsoft Windows Operating Systems
Windows 10
- Processor: 1 gigahertz (GHz) or faster
- RAM: 1 gigabyte (GB) for 32-bit or 2 GB for 64-bit
Windows 8.1 / Windows 8
- Processor: 1 GHz or faster
- RAM: 1 GB for 32-bit or 2 GB for 64-bit
Windows 7
- Processor: 1 GHz or faster
- RAM: 1 GB for 32-bit or 2 GB for 64-bit
Windows Vista
- Processor: 1 GHz or faster
- RAM: 1 GB
Windows XP (32-bit) (Service Pack 3)
- Processor: 300 Megahertz (MHz) Pentium or faster
- RAM: 512 MB
POP3 email clients compatibility
Quick Heal Total Security Multi-Device supports
- Microsoft Outlook Express 5.5 and later
- Microsoft Outlook 2000 and later
- Netscape Messenger 4 and later
- Eudora
- Mozilla Thunderbird
- IncrediMail
- Windows Mail
Quick Heal Total Security Multi-Device does not support
- IMAP
- AOL
- POP3s with Secure Sockets Layer (SSL)
- Web-based email such as Hotmail and Yahoo! Mail
- Lotus Notes
Note: The Email Protection feature of Quick Heal Total Security Multi-Device is not supported on encrypted email connections that use Secure Sockets Layer (SSL).
